As posted above, I haven't been worried about zinc cntamination. I just loooked up the melting point of zinc and found it is 787 degrees F. If the infamous zinc wheelweights are pure zinc, then all we need do to be safe is keep smelting temperature well under 787 and skim off any floating weights.

To be sure, use the acid test, muriatic that is.

Dip a suspect WW in a small container of muriatic acid.

If it is coated with something, first break through the coating with cutting pliers.

If it is zinc, it will fizz like an alka seltzer. Turns the acid blackish.

If lead or steel, no zinc, nothing happens.

Be careful; it is acid. Commom cleaner usually found with the paints.

Zinc suckers are here to stay for sure, lead is not allowed in wheel weights since 1st of August this year (EU). Maybe I'll need to experience making bullets out of it some day. My Father-in-law dropped bucket full of weights to my porch while passing by (how about that 8), eh?), so I made quick check up what I have there. So far so good; there's zinc weights alright, but so far they've been recognizable. First pic shows two zinc weights on the left and two very similar looking lead weights on the right. Picture shows how one can make sure which one is which, knife cuts lead easily making nice curved chips, but only scratches zinc, chips break easily leaving very short separate pieces, clear metal shine in cut is obvious in both:
http://pyssymiehet.com/casting/zinclead1.jpg


Second picture shows difference between 20 gram zinc weight and 25 gram lead weight. Not much difference except markings! These two modern weights with circulation markings (Zn and Pb) are very very similar by looks and easily mixed without being extra careful. I simply cannot say just by feel which one is which, but this type of zinc weight seems to be carrying Zn marking. Marking could be by law here; there's circulation marks in every plastic piece today, so why not in these. Of course knife tells the story easily:

My simple instructions are that if I don't see Zn marking and I'm suspicious, I just cut it with a knife and compare to lead weight. By keeping temperature low enough, it's probably possible to pick up weight which doesn't melt immediately, but that I know better after processing this batch when I have time.

Your situation is a perfect reason to get a proper lead thermometer. I had one from Lyman and it was not particularly accurate. I ordered one from Bill Ferguson and am very happy with it:

http://www.theantimonyman.com/thermometry.htm

With a good lead thermometer, you can easily keep your smelter below 650 degrees or so. Any wheel weights that float at that temperature is something to remove from the melt, NOW!
